Benefits of arts education

Arts education encompasses various disciplines, including creative writing, dance, music, theater, and visual arts. Through arts education, students learn valuable life skills, including creativity, cooperation, discipline, and critical analysis. Additionally, it provides students with positive means of self-expression and empowers them to find their voice.

Arts education offers a wide range of benefits for students, contributing to their overall development and enriching their learning experience. It can have a positive impact on students by helping them:

  • Enhance engagement at school and reduce stress
  • Develop vital social-emotional and interpersonal skills
  • Enrich their overall experiences and perspectives
  • Learn to handle constructive criticism gracefully
  • Improve their ability to focus and concentrate

By teaching the arts, teachers can also instill a lifelong appreciation and enjoyment of various art forms, encouraging students to continue exploring and participating in creative activities throughout their lives.
